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/owncloud/client.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Klaas Freitag <freitag@owncloud.com>2015-11-04 18:40:22 +0300
committerKlaas Freitag <freitag@owncloud.com>2015-11-04 18:40:22 +0300
commitcb1571c6c57e7617454737abe7dd1ff23066249b (patch)
tree150db5722a99e8c22224182735b302b61f55d3dc /src/gui/activitywidget.h
parent3bccfb89934d13c9391275e99aa5dcb246439f0b (diff)
ActivityWidget: Rather use accountState pointer directly.
Do not use it via a smart pointer class.
Diffstat (limited to 'src/gui/activitywidget.h')
-rw-r--r--src/gui/activitywidget.h10
1 files changed, 6 insertions, 4 deletions
diff --git a/src/gui/activitywidget.h b/src/gui/activitywidget.h
index 6f6db93de..5981c297a 100644
--- a/src/gui/activitywidget.h
+++ b/src/gui/activitywidget.h
@@ -30,6 +30,7 @@ class QPushButton;
namespace OCC {
class Account;
+class AccountStatusPtr;
namespace Ui {
class ActivityWidget;
@@ -89,19 +90,19 @@ public:
void fetchMore(const QModelIndex&);
public slots:
- void slotRefreshActivity(AccountStatePtr ast);
+ void slotRefreshActivity(AccountState* ast);
private slots:
void slotActivitiesReceived(const QVariantMap& json);
private:
- void startFetchJob(AccountStatePtr s);
+ void startFetchJob(AccountState* s);
void combineActivityLists();
QString timeSpanFromNow(const QDateTime& dt) const;
- QMap<AccountStatePtr, ActivityList> _activityLists;
+ QMap<AccountState*, ActivityList> _activityLists;
ActivityList _finalList;
- QSet<AccountStatePtr> _currentlyFetching;
+ QSet<AccountState*> _currentlyFetching;
};
/**
@@ -121,6 +122,7 @@ public:
public slots:
void slotOpenFile();
+ void slotRefresh(AccountState* ptr);
protected slots:
void copyToClipboard();